Tips for Buying Retail Stores In Metro Vancouver Regional District, BC
Understand the Local Market Dynamics
Retail in Metro Vancouver is highly influenced by demographic trends, tourism patterns, and shifting consumer preferences. Before making a purchase, thoroughly research the neighbourhoods within the regional district—places like Downtown Vancouver, Burnaby, and Richmond each have unique customer bases. Pay close attention to foot traffic, visibility, and accessibility, as these factors can significantly affect a store’s performance. Study recent retail real estate trends and economic forecasts for Metro Vancouver to ensure you’re buying in a thriving or emerging location rather than one in decline.
Analyze Financial Performance & Inventory Management
It’s essential to review several years of financial statements for any retail store you are considering. Look for consistent revenue streams, profitable margins, and manageable operating expenses. Check how well inventory turns over: excessive unsold stock may indicate poor selection, pricing, or inventory management. Ask for detailed inventory lists and assess if current stock aligns with current market demand. Seek professional help to verify the numbers and spot any financial red flags such as declining sales or hidden debts.
Assess Lease Terms and Landlord Relations
The success of a retail business in Metro Vancouver is often linked closely to its lease. Lease rates can be high and locations competitive. Carefully review the current lease agreement for renewal options, rent escalation clauses, and any restrictions that might limit your ability to grow the business or change the product line. Understand the landlord-tenant relationship: is the landlord accommodative and responsive? Building a good rapport with the property owner can be invaluable, especially if you want to negotiate favourable terms or address issues after taking over the business.
